If compression pressure is below minimum value, check valve clearances and parts associated with
combustion chamber (valve, valve seat, piston, pi ston ring, cylinder bore, cylinder head, cylinder head
gasket). After the checking, measure compression pressure again.
If some cylinders have low compression pressure, pour small amount of engine oil into the spark plug
hole of the cylinder to re-check it for compression.
- If the added engine oil improves the compression, piston rings may be worn out or damaged. Check the piston rings and replace if necessary.
- If the compression pressure remains at low level despite the addition of engine oil, valves may be mal- functioning. Check valves for damage. Repl ace valve or valve seat accordingly.
If two adjacent cylinders have respectively low compression pressure and their compression remains low even after the addition of engine oil, cylinder head gaskets are leaking. In such a case, replace cyl-
inder head gaskets.

WHEEL BEARING INSPECTION
Move wheel hub in the axial direction by hand. Che ck that there is no looseness of front wheel bearing.
Rotate wheel hub and make sure there is no unusual noise or other irregular conditions. If there are any irregular conditions, replace wheel hub and bearing assembly.

FRONT DRIVE SHAFT
On-Vehicle InspectionINFOID:0000000001327515
Check drive shaft mounting point and joint for looseness and other damage.
Check boot for cracks and other damage. CAUTION:
Replace entire drive shaft assembly when noi se or vibration occur from drive shaft.
DRIVE SHAFT BOOT REPLACEMENT
1. Remove tires from vehicle with power tool.
2. Remove undercover with power tool.
3. Remove cotter pin. Then remove lock nut from drive shaft with power tool.
4. Remove wheel sensor harness fr om strut assembly. Refer to BRC-52
.
CAUTION:
Do not pull on wheel sensor harness.
5. Remove brake hose lock plate. Then remove brake hose from strut assembly. Refer to BR-10
.
6. Remove fixing bolts and nuts between strut assembly and steering knuckle with power tool.
7. Remove drive shaft from wheel hub and bearing assembly.
8. Using a puller (suitable tool), remove drive shaft from steering knuckle.
CAUTION:
When removing drive shaf t, do not apply an excessive
angle to drive shaft joint. Al so be careful not to excessively
extend slide joint.
9. Remove boot bands, and then remove boot from joint sub-assembly.
10. Screw a drive shaft puller (suitable tool) into joint sub-assembly screw part to a length of 30 mm (1.18 in) or more. Support drive
shaft with one hand and pull out joint sub-assembly with a slid-
ing hammer (suitable tool) from shaft.
CAUTION:
• Align a sliding hammer and drive shaft and remove them
by pulling firmly and uniformly.
If joint sub-assembly cannot be pulled out, try after
removing drive shaft from vehicle.
11. Remove the circular clip from shaft.
12. Remove boot from shaft.
13. Clean the old grease on joint sub-assembly with paper towels.
